Re: Trailer lights ?? really lost

if your lights go off at any point you probably got a ground screwed up on that circuit. Its gotta be in the brake wiring. When you hit the brake its shorting to ground. your running lights and turn signals are screwed up recheck. you should put all the wires back on your ford and buy an adapter 7 to 4 and a test light to find out whats doing what as far as turn signals, brakes, running lights, 12v+, ground, reverse lights(Surge brake lock out)


GREEN grass on my RIGHT(turn)
YELLOW stripe to my LEFT(turn)
BROWN underwear without LIGHTS(running)
white is ground
blue is reverse
as far as the truck the test light hooked to frame(neg) will tell you.
